2024 Compare Climate & Weather:
Huntsville, AL vs Houston, TX
Change Cities
Highlights
On average, there are 204 sunny days per year in Houston. Huntsville averages 199 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.
Houston, Texas gets 53 inches of rain, on average, per year. Huntsville, Alabama gets 54.7 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.
Houston averages 0 inches of snow per year. Huntsville averages 1.6 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

August is the hottest month for Huntsville with an average high temperature of 90.5°, which ranks it as about average compared to other places in Alabama. In Huntsville,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Huntsville are May, October and April.
August is the hottest month for Houston with an average high temperature of 93.6°, which ranks it as cooler than most places in Texas. In Houston,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Houston are April, October and November.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Huntsville with an average of 29.6°. This is colder than most places in Alabama.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Houston with an average of 43.4°. This is warmer than most places in Texas.
In Huntsville, there are 52.4 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is about average compared to other places in Alabama.
In Houston, there are 95.9 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is about average compared to other places in Texas.
In Huntsville, there are 66.9 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is colder than most places in Alabama.
In Houston, there are 7.8 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is warmer than most places in Texas.
In Huntsville, there are 0.2 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is one of the coldest places in Alabama.
In Houston,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in Texas.
December is the wettest month in Huntsville with 5.8 inches of rain, and the driest month is August with 3.5 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 29% of yearly precipitation and 22%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 54.7 inches in Huntsville means that it is drier than most places in Alabama.
June is the wettest month in Houston with 6.2 inches of rain, and the driest month is February with 3.2 inches. The wettest season is Autumn with 29% of yearly precipitation and 21%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 53.0 inches in Houston means that it is one of the wettest places in Texas.
December is the rainiest month in Huntsville with 11.2 days of rain, and September is the driest month with only 7.7 rainy days. There are 120.3 rainy days annually in Huntsville, which is one of the rainiest places in Alabama.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 27% of the time and the driest is Winter with only a 21% chance of a rainy day.
June is the rainiest month in Houston with 9.3 days of rain, and April is the driest month with only 5.7 rainy days. There are 90.0 rainy days annually in Houston, which is rainier than most places in Texas. The rainiest season is Autumn when it rains 28% of the time and the driest is Summer with only a 22% chance of a rainy day.
An annual snowfall of 1.6 inches in Huntsville means that it is snowier than most places in Alabama.
There is rarely any recorded snowfall in Houston, ranking it as one of the least snowy places in Texas.
January is the snowiest month in Huntsville with 0.7 inches of snow, and 1 month of the year have significant snowfall.
Any measurable snowfall is a rare occurance in Houston.

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.
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.
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
